Brookline's Eliot Recreation Center at 133 Eliot St. closed Thursday, Sept. 3, for an internal renovation expected to last through the end of the year.

The building is fully shut to the public to allow contractors to work safely. All programs previously scheduled at the Eliot Center are being relocated, and families affected will be notified directly with new locations, according to the town's announcement. Families who cannot make an alternative site work will receive a full refund.

Playgrounds and fields at Warren Park stay open.

What's getting fixed

Funded by the town's FY26 Capital Improvement Project budget, the renovation will add a dedicated meeting and conference room, update all four staff and public restrooms, and replace office furniture, carpet, technology and electrical systems. The scope also includes repainting. The work follows recent exterior upgrades, including a new roof and a rebuilt ground-level classroom.

No project cost has been released.

Where to find Recreation staff

The Recreation Department's administrative offices have moved to the Brookline Environmental Education Center (BEEC) at 652 Hammond St. for the duration. Hours there are Monday through Thursday, 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. Fridays are by appointment only; call 617-730-2069 to schedule.

Registration and reservations remain available online at BrooklineRec.com. Staff contacts are listed on the Recreation Directory webpage.

Indoor restrooms at the Eliot Center are closed, but portable units have been placed on-site for park visitors.

Capital investment context

Recreation Director Tim Davis and Assistant Director Aaron Friedman, in a September 2025 department newsletter, called the town's commitment to its Recreation Department "a major factor in our decision to return," citing "sustained capital improvements" among the reasons they chose to lead the department.

The Eliot Center renovation is the latest project in that capital pipeline. The town has not announced a specific reopening date, saying only that the work is scheduled to wrap by year's end.
